WebOn a very basic level, yes, boiling a chicken carcass in water makes chicken broth. There’s more to stock making technique than that though. Herbs and vegetables are added to give the broth complexity of flavor and it must be skimmed to remove impurities while cooking. At the heart of the matter though boiled bird does make stock. 35 WebAug 7, 2024 · What is the white foam on boiling chicken?
